To celebrate the release of the new season of Party Down, which comes to Lionsgate+ this week, we sat down with some of the show’s incredible ensemble to find out more.

It’s ten years later and most of the most of the Party Down catering team have moved on, including actor/bartender Henry Pollard (Adam Scott, “Severance,” “Parks and Recreation”). After a surprise reunion, the gang find themselves once again stoically enduring the procession of random parties and oddball guests all over Los Angeles.

First, we chat to Martin Starr (Roman Debeers) and Ryan Hansen (Kyle Bradway) about the long-awaited series three that has been thirteen years in the making, the surprises in store both for audiences and for them as actors on their return, the incredible ensemble and the unique energy that they bring to the screen, their favourite moments on the show and much more.

Next, we chat to newcomers to the team Tyrel Jackson Williams (Sackson) and Zoe Chao (Lucy Dang) about joining the show and the love of the series prior to joining, the comedic nature of the set, the shrewd mix of comedy and pathos throughout the series, working with Adam Scott, Jane Lynch and more, why they are just as excited as audiences are to see the show and much more.
